    repair of 1/2" breaker bar tool

    So ages ago I rescued a 1/2" breaker bar which was being tossed because pieces were missing - essentially all that was left was the 450mm (18") handle portion.

    I determined that the hinge screw thread was a metric 8mm, and I then used a 20mm structural bolt as stock to make up the missing 1/2" square drive piece.

    I drilled the cross hole, and then used that as my reference for the grinding/ cutting the bolt down to the rough shape, and then resorted to files to bring it in to final size and fit.
    I made the cross pin/screw by threading the shank of a long 8mm bolt so I had plain shank for the drive to swivel on, and then turning down the head of the bolt to form the dome head screw you see in the photos.

    It's a little rough in places, but very useable.
